    Roys biggest test on his chin is when he put on 20 lbs and got in the ring with Ruiz who still outweighed him by 30lbs and landed flush right hands on his face in the first round... he stumbled back one step, and then fired right back.

    I would say that was his biggest test of his career.

    Doesn't mean it's granite, but it's certainly not weak.

          Depends on what you categorize as a good/bad chin, many will tell you that Terry Norris had a chin of pure glass but if you watch him fight you start to realize that if his chin was that poor than why did it take so long for him to get found out? its not like he never fought punchers and its not like he did not engage the opponent, most of the time he went toe to toe and ****** it out with the opponent.


          I dont think Tito had a shaky chin either but many others will probably disagree. I feel Tito drained himself to make weight a lot but how many times was badly hurt to where he was on the point of been taking out? he always got up and proceeded to beat the **** outta the opponent.

          Junior Jones is someone who had a pure glass chin because when he got hurt he almost never recovered, Amir Khan is prolly in the same category imo.
